New: Rests in synceditor guide notes

We’ve made an improvement to our synceditor: the “guide notes” now include rests.

“Guide notes” are what we call the notes that we overlay on the synceditor’s waveform. You can drag them to do fine-grained syncing at the level of individual notes.

With this new change, you now have the ability to set the syncing for rests — not just for notes.

Previously we didn’t offer this functionality because we thought it wouldn’t be needed...but it turns out there are some valid reasons you might want to specify the syncpoint of a specific rest. For example, you might want to specify the syncpoint for the end of the previously sustained note).
